At Delaware Electric Cooperative (DEC), it’s the job of employees to provide safe, reliable and competitively priced energy services to empower their members to improve their quality of life, but the Co-op’s commitment to the communities it serves goes beyond electrification. 

For over 15 years, the Co-op has worked with the Children’s Choice program to provide underprivileged children within its service territory presents for Christmas as part of the yearly Angel Tree initiative. This year, DEC’s employees rose to the occasion again to make the  holiday brighter. During this season of giving, employees bought presents for 43 children, ensuring they will have something to open on Christmas Day. According to Co-op employee Teresa McCann – DEC’s coordinator for the Children’s Choice Angel Tree project – employee participation in events like this helps demonstrate employees’ concern for those they power.

“I am proud to work with a team of people so dedicated to giving back to the communities we serve,” McCann says. “Thanks to their generosity, these kids will have gifts to unwrap this year, and to me, that spirit of giving represents the true reason for the season.”

Children’s Choice is a nonprofit social service agency that provides services for children in need, foster care and adoption services. The organization has more than one dozen offices in five states.
